Behold, I will bring them from the north country, and gather them from the coasts of the earth, and with them the blind and the lame, the woman with child and her that travaileth with child together: a great company shall return thither.

Bible References

The coasts

Psalm 65:5
By awesome things in righteousness You will answer us, O God of our salvation; who are the hope of all the ends of the earth and the sea, of those far away.
Psalm 98:3
He has remembered His mercy and His truth toward the house of Israel; all the ends of the earth have seen the salvation of Jehovah.
Isaiah 43:6
I will say to the north, Give up; and to the south, Do not keep back; bring My sons from far and My daughters from the ends of the earth;
Isaiah 45:22
Turn to Me, and be saved, all the ends of the earth; for I am God, and there is no other.
Isaiah 52:10
Jehovah has bared His holy arm in the eyes of all the nations; and all the ends of the earth shall see the salvation of our God.
Ezekiel 20:34
And I will bring you out from the people, and I will gather you out of the lands in which you are scattered among them, with a mighty hand and with a stretched out arm and with fury poured out.
Ezekiel 34:13
And I will bring them out from the peoples, and gather them from the lands, and will bring them to their own land and feed them on the mountain of Israel by the rivers, and in all the places of the land where people live.
